This was taken by Fangzhen Lin, a logician at the Hong Kong University of Science and Technology, who arranged our visit to Zhongshan University, the leading university in Guangdong province. This university was named after the father of the modern Chinese republic, Dr Sun Yat Sen. His statue adorns the center of the campus, a beautiful blend of ancient and modern Chinese architecture. Quaintly, the Cantonese superstition of Feng Shui is alive and well in this campus. The front entrance of the Institute of Cognitive Science where Norman gave his lecture is closed; entry is by a side door. Reason: bad feng shui at the front.
